reference, declarationdefinition
definition → references, declarations, derived classes, virtual overrides
reference to multiple definitions → definitions
unreferenced

References

lib/Transforms/Scalar/LoopRerollPass.cpp
  261       void addSLR(SimpleLoopReduction &SLR) { PossibleReds.push_back(SLR); }
  279         for (unsigned i = 0, e = PossibleReds.size(); i != e; ++i)
  280           if (PossibleReds[i].size() % Scale == 0) {
  281             PossibleRedLastSet.insert(PossibleReds[i].getReducedValue());
  282             PossibleRedPHISet.insert(PossibleReds[i].getPHI());
  284             PossibleRedSet.insert(PossibleReds[i].getPHI());
  285             PossibleRedIdx[PossibleReds[i].getPHI()] = i;
  286             for (Instruction *J : PossibleReds[i]) {
 1510     for (Instruction *J : PossibleReds[i]) {
 1516           !PossibleReds[i].getReducedValue()->isAssociative()) {
 1554     for (int e = PossibleReds[i].size(); j != e; ++j)
 1555       if (PossibleRedIter[PossibleReds[i][j]] != 0) {
 1562     for (User *U : PossibleReds[i].getReducedValue()->users()) {
 1567       User->replaceUsesOfWith(PossibleReds[i].getReducedValue(),
 1568                               PossibleReds[i][j]);